What is a research assistant professor in neuroimaging?

A Research Assistant Professor in Neuroimaging is an early-career academic who conducts independent and collaborative research using advanced imaging techniques to study the structure and function of the brain and nervous system. This position is typically non-tenure track and focuses primarily on research, often involving the development or application of neuroimaging methods such as MRI, PET, or fMRI. In addition to research, they may mentor students, collaborate with other faculty, and contribute to grant writing and publication of scientific findings.

What are the key skills and qualifications needed to thrive as a research assistant professor in neuroimaging?

To thrive as a Research Assistant Professor in Neuroimaging, a PhD in neuroscience, biomedical engineering, or a related field with expertise in neuroimaging techniques is essential. Proficiency with imaging software (such as SPM, FSL, or AFNI), programming languages (like Python or MATLAB), and familiarity with MRI or PET systems is typically required. Strong analytical thinking, scientific communication, and collaborative skills help distinguish top candidates in this academic and research-intensive role. These skills ensure rigorous research output, effective teamwork, and the ability to secure funding or publish impactful findings.

What are some common challenges faced by a research assistant professor in neuroimaging, and how can they be addressed?

As a Research Assistant Professor in Neuroimaging, common challenges include balancing independent research with collaborative projects, securing funding through grants, and staying current with rapidly evolving imaging technologies. Managing multiple projects and mentoring students or junior researchers can also be demanding. To address these challenges, effective time management, building strong interdisciplinary networks, and actively seeking mentorship or collaboration opportunities within and outside your institution can be very beneficial.

Research Assistant Professor Positions (Research Track)

The Department of Biomedical Engineering (BME) in the University of Miami (UM) College of Engineering, the Desai Sethi Urology Institute and the Miami Project to cure paralysis at UM Health system have multiple exciting opportunities for Research Assistant Professors, with the earliest start date of June 01, 2024. These positions are sponsored by multiple NIH Research Grants and UM to continue long-term research projects in the laboratory of Prof. Yingchun Zhang.

Zhang's research aims to achieve the long-term goal of advancing Precision Rehabilitation. This will be accomplished through the comprehensive and quantitative assessment of dynamic activation and interactions of the brain, muscles, and brain-to-muscle pathways, using a combination of multimodal neuroimaging, neuroengineering, and neuromodulation techniques. Current research is dedicated to the advancement of innovative technologies aimed at achieving quantitative and precise diagnosis, phenotyping, and personalized treatment for a variety of neurological, neurodegenerative, and neuromuscular conditions. These conditions encompass psychiatric disorders, Alzheimer's disease (AD), stroke, spinal cord injury, pelvic floor dysfunctions, as well as the resultant movement disorders and pain conditions.

The Research Assistant Professor will primarily work with Prof. Zhang and will also be embedded in the multidisciplinary team of investigators from BME at UM, and scientists/clinicians from the Desai Sethi Urology Institute and the Miami Project to cure paralysis at UM Health system. The position provides faculty level salary support, benefits, and a platform for professional growth including grant writing.
